Random number generators

Random number generators are the unspoken heroes of slot sites machines, ensuring that every spin is fair and unpredictable. They are also the brains of science behind payout percentages. The entire idea behind slot games is based on the concept of randomness. You'd never be able to tell if you'd been drinking champagne or sighing with dismay without it. This is why it's crucial to know how RNGs work.

The slot machine's Random Number Generator (RNG) is a microprocessor that generates the sequence of numbers at a dazzling rate. These numbers are then mapped onto different symbols on the virtual reels. When you spin the reels the button, a random number will be selected from the continuous stream to determine which symbols appear on your reels. This happens in a fraction of a second which makes slot games exciting and unpredictable.

The RNG of the slot machine can generate thousands of combinations in milliseconds. This process repeats itself every time you press the spin button. Every single decision - from choice of a symbol to whether or whether you win a jackpot - is dependent on the random number. Paylines

Paylines are the lines that matching symbols must cross to trigger a payout. These lines could be simple and straight, or they can be a continuous line that runs across the reels in a zig-zag fashion. In both cases at least three symbols must be on the paylines for the winning combination. The majority of slot machine wins result from combinations that hit paylines. Typically, these combinations will require forming from the left-most side of the screen to the right-most. However, there are some games that have paylines that can run both ways or even diagonally.

Slot machines come in a wide variety of shapes and sizes, ranging from simple three-reel single-payline slot machines to huge games that provide hundreds of ways to win. While many of these features are exciting however, they can make the game a bit confusing and difficult to comprehend. Fortunately, the most important information about paylines and ways-to-win can be found in the pay table of each slot machine.

You'll need to know the amount of paylines, and whether they're fixed or adjustable before you start playing on a machine. You can choose the number of paylines that you want to bet on prior to every spin. Fixed-payline games require you to bet on all paylines in order to play.
